Contents: Plant nutrition: fertilizer recommendations; nitrogen; phosphorus and silicon; sulphur; soil acidity; foliar diagnosis; Irrigation: Drip irrigation: industrial projects, Laval separator, drip irrigation trials; Overhead irrigation: irrigation regimes, performence of sprinklers, irrigation development; Maturity trials, 1977 series; Physiological basis of yield variation; Gibberellic acid; Ripener "Polaris": response of new varieties, regrowth studies, effect of different dosage and application rates, results of commercial application; Other ripeners; Cultural practices: minimum tillage practice; effect of methods of loading and cutting on cane yield. | |
